You can just make out the boom of the aerial truck is the photo below. That one had a lot of work to accomplish controlling this fire.
View attachment 263002
Started around 11:00 AM this morning, it is 3:00 PM now and they are still pouring water on it. The burning building was apartments, the "creamery" on the right was being used by a local guy for his carving shop, the local lumberyard is to the left. The lumberyard appears to have escaped unscathed, the creamery will have smoke and water damage.
